Which Should I Use for Edging - Edge Banding or Veneer?274


As a leading manufacturer of edge banding products in China, we are often asked about the difference between edge banding and wood veneer and which one customers should use for their projects. Both have their own unique advantages and disadvantages, so the best choice for you depends on your specific requirements. Here is a comprehensive guide to help you make an informed decision:

1. Cost

Edge banding is typically more cost-effective than wood veneer. This is because it is made from thin strips of wood or other materials that are bonded to the edges of the substrate. Wood veneer, on the other hand, is made from thin sheets of wood that are glued to the surface of the substrate. The process of making wood veneer is more labor-intensive, which is reflected in the higher cost.

2. Durability

Edge banding is more durable than wood veneer. This is because it is applied to the edges of the substrate, which are more exposed to wear and tear. Wood veneer, on the other hand, is applied to the surface of the substrate, which is less exposed to damage. However, it is important to note that the durability of both edge banding and wood veneer can be affected by the type of material used.

3. Appearance

Edge banding can be made from a variety of materials, including wood, metal, and plastic. This gives you a wide range of options to choose from to match the look of your project. Wood veneer, on the other hand, is made from real wood, which gives it a natural and luxurious look. However, it is important to note that wood veneer is not as resistant to fading as edge banding, so it may not be the best choice for projects that will be exposed to a lot of sunlight.

4. Installation

Edge banding is typically applied with an adhesive. This can be a messy and time-consuming process, but it is relatively easy to do. Wood veneer, on the other hand, is applied with a veneer press. This is a more complex process, but it produces a more durable bond.

5. Environmental impact

Edge banding is typically made from renewable materials, such as wood and paper. This makes it a more environmentally friendly option than wood veneer, which is made from non-renewable resources. However, it is important to note that some types of edge banding, such as PVC, are not biodegradable.

Conclusion

So, which should you use for edging - edge banding or wood veneer? The best choice for you depends on your specific requirements. If you are looking for a cost-effective, durable, and easy-to-install option, then edge banding is a good choice. If you are looking for a natural and luxurious look, then wood veneer is a good choice. Ultimately, the best way to decide which option is right for you is to consult with a professional.
